....r per : Justice K.K. Usha, President]. - The present appeal which is referred for being considered by the Larger Bench relates to the maintainability of an appeal before the Tribunal from an interim order of stay passed by the Commissioner (Appeals) under Section 35F of the Central Excise Act, 1944. 2. The appellant herein challenged the interim order passed by the Commissioner (Appeals) before....
